Lynk & Co 06 is a domestic vehicle. LYNK & CO (Chinese name: Lingke) is an automotive brand jointly established by Geely Holding Group, Geely Auto Group, and Volvo Cars. Based on the CMA (Compact Modular Architecture) platform, co-developed by Volvo Cars and Geely Auto Group and led by Volvo Cars, the Lynk & Co 01 officially entered the Chinese market, followed by the European and American markets.
